Common Questions
What fence materials work best with Glen Ellyn's soil and pest conditions?
Glen Ellyn has moderate soil corrosivity and termite risk. Galvanized steel posts and fasteners are recommended over standard steel to prevent rust streaks. For wood, use pressure-treated lumber rated for ground contact. Avoid untreated wood posts in direct soil contact. Composite materials offer high resistance to both corrosion and pests but require specific UV-stabilized formulations.
What are the height and setback rules for a fence on my property?
Glen Ellyn zoning limits fences to 3 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ear/side yards. The 0-foot setback allows installation directly on the property line. For corner lots, a visibility 'sight triangle' must be maintained, especially near high-traffic corridors like I-355. This requires a lower, see-through fence within 25 feet of the intersection corner to prevent traffic sightline obstruction.
How deep should my fence posts be set in Glen Ellyn?
Posts must be set below the 42-inch frost line common to Illinois. In Downtown Glen Ellyn, above-grade posts will heave from freeze-thaw cycles, causing structural failure. The IRC requires foundations to extend below this line to prevent frost lift. For a 6-foot fence, a 9-foot total post with 42+ inches in concrete is standard for stability.

Is my fence designed to handle high winds?
Design for the V-ult wind speed of 105 mph, as per ASCE 7-22 standards for this region. This engineering rating dictates post spacing, concrete footing size, and bracket strength. A 6-foot privacy fence in an open area near Lake Ellyn Park requires closer post spacing (e.g., 6 feet on-center instead of 8) and diagonal bracing to survive peak storm season gusts without panel failure.
What are my legal obligations to my neighbor when building a fence?
The Illinois Boundary Fence Act (765 ILCS 130/1) requires written notice to adjoining landowners at least 30 days before replacing a shared boundary fence. In Glen Ellyn, this 2026 legal requirement is absolute. If the fence is entirely on your property, notification is a courtesy but not mandated by this statute. Always document all correspondence.
Can I install a smart gate on my pool fence?
Yes, but the gate must first comply with Illinois pool safety code: self-closing, self-latching, with the latch mechanism at least 54 inches above grade. Modern IoT gate operators can integrate with these mechanical latches, providing remote access logs and automation. This combination meets both modern liability standards and the moderate smart-gate trend in the area.
What are the critical steps before excavation begins?
Call JULIE (811) at least three business days before digging to mark all public underground utilities. Hitting a gas or fiber line in Downtown Glen Ellyn is a major liability and repair cost. Concurrently, file for a fence permit with the Glen Ellyn permit office. The contractor typically manages this paperwork, which includes a site plan showing the fence location relative to property lines and structures.
